   Well here is what I have.  Margaret’s obit is from:

Glendale News-Press  Nov. 13, 1980  sent to me by Anita Schmidt [anitaschmidt@earthlink.net] a volunteer in California in an email msg dated 8/23/2000  8 pm.

 

She also sent me the following info:

 

“The following information is from Forest Lawn Memorial Park Cemetery - Glendale:

 

Margaret Anna Clewley        Space 4, Lot 816, Memory Slope

Harry C. Clewley                 Space 3                                          died 8/6/55        70 years, interred 8/9

Harry Clyde Clewley            Space 8, Lot 815, Memory Slope      died 10/11/53    32 years”

 

 

Recv’d email transcription of death cert  for Harry Cyrus Clewley from Judy Haugh Claremont [jhaugh@cyberg8t.com]  Mon 9/18/00 9:09 PM.

 

“Harry C. Clewley

born: 17 Oct 1884, Maine

SS# 550-05-2511

residence: 1005 W. Orange Grove Ave., Burbank

age: 70

occupation: machinist (aircraft)

father: Alvah Clewley, born Maine

mother: unknown

spouse: Margaret A. Clewley

informant: wife

died 6 Aug 1955, 1:00 p.m. at home

cause of death: not stated

burial: 9 Aug 1955 at Forest Lawn

mortuary: A.C. Fillbach, Burbank

physician: David V. Hubbell, 2301 W. Magnolia, Burbank”

 

Death Certificate transcription for Harry Clyde Clewley done by Judy Haugh Claremont [jhaugh@cyberg8t.com]  Random Acts of Genealogical Kindness  9/25/2000

 

born: 7/5/20, Massachusetts

marital status at time of death: married

SS# 552-20-6950

armed forces: WWII

residence: 8223 Cantaloupe Ave., Van Nuys

occupation: tester, manufacturing

length of stay in CA: 29 yrs.

father: Harry C. Clewley, born Maine

mother: Priscilla Clewley

died: 10/11/53 ...found at 7 a.m.

where: at home

age: 33

cause of death: carbon monoxide poisoning in the garage, due to inhalation of auto exhaust

embalmed: yes

burial: 10/15/53

where: Forest Lawn

 

I haven’t figured out why Priscilla is listed as mother.
